§ 276.481 — Inspection of premises and records — dealers may be required to report — transporters to have proper records — director to investigate.

Text
1.The director or any auditor appointed pursuant to the provisions of section 276.476 may inspect the premises used by any person licensed under sections 276.401 to 276.581 , or persons who the director has reasonable cause to believe should be licensed under sections 276.401 to 276.581 , in the conduct of his business at any time. The books, accounts, records and papers of every grain dealer shall at all times during business hours be subject to inspection as prescribed by the director.
2.The director may perform such inspections as are necessary for the orderly administration of the provisions of sections 276.401 to 276.581 based upon reports and other information available to him.
